A Tapestry of Architectural Styles

The diversity of French boutique design reflects the rich tapestry of architectural styles found in Paris. From the neoclassical elegance of the Faubourg Saint-Honoré to the bohemian charm of the Marais, each district has its own unique aesthetic. Strolling through the city's streets, shoppers can discover a kaleidoscope of architectural wonders, each offering a different chapter in the story of Parisian retail.
